The Hyundai Accent is a five-passenger subcompact sedan competing with the Toyota Yaris, Honda Fit, and Ford Fiesta. Every Accent model comes with a 120-hp 1.6-liter four-cylinder engine for an EPA-estimated 36 mpg combined. Trim levels include the SE, SEL, and Limited. So, which one is the best? Critics agree it’s the mid-range SEL. Here’s why.

If you’re looking for a car that’s stylish yet practical, the 2022 Hyundai Accent SEL is a great option. Car and Driver, MotorTrend, and Edmunds all recommend the SEL, with the last saying this trim gives “the most bang for [the] buck.”

It boasts a sleek design, plenty of cargo space, and plenty of features that make driving more enjoyable. You get all of that for under $19,000.

The Accent SEL shares a sleek, aerodynamic design with the SE and Limited trims. And the SEL’s 15-inch alloy wheels add a touch of sophistication.

Inside, the Accent SEL is equally impressive. The cabin is surprisingly spacious and comfortable for a subcompact car, with plenty of room for five passengers. 

In addition, the SEL comes with a 7.0-inch touchscreen display audio system with Android Auto and Apple CarPlay integration. Also, expect remote keyless entry, cruise control, upgraded cloth upholstery, automatic halogen headlights, and electronic stability control.

What features come with the Limited trim?

Starting at $20,645, the Limited comes with all the features of the SEL plus the following, according to Edmunds:

  • LED projector headlights
  • 17-inch alloy wheels
  • Keyless entry
  • Push-button ignition
  • Leather-wrapped steering wheel and shift knob
  • Leatherette upholstery
  • Heated front seats
  • Automatic climate control
  • Sunroof

Safety features include forward-collision avoidance assist with automatic emergency braking, lane-keeping assist, and a rearview camera.

What is the difference between the 2022 Hyundai Accent SE and SEL?

The Hyundai Accent SE is the entry-level trim, priced at $17,690. It comes with 15-inch steel wheels, manual front seats, air conditioning, cloth upholstery, and a height-adjustable driver’s seat.

Additional features include a tilt-and-telescoping steering wheel, a trip computer, Bluetooth connectivity, and a four-speaker sound system with a CD player and an auxiliary audio jack. 

The Accent SE also comes with front seatbelts with pre-tensioners and load limiters, front airbags, side curtain airbags, antilock brakes, electronic stability control, a rearview camera, and a tire pressure monitoring system, among other safety features.

The 2022 Hyundai Accent is a competent car that does everything just right. Its SEL trim is a can’t-miss for reviewers when it comes to choosing the best trim in terms of value. For the cost of a little more, you’ll get a lot of extras.
